3. MiBUS OBE
A. OBE
OBE as the core device of the OBE system with 7-inch LCD with all of the inf
ormation collected and processed is a device that performs. OBE coordinates
of the GPS Module is based on the current location and status information of
the bus created, and also through various car devices and interfaces, the st
ate of the car (fuel state, RPM, etc.) and information (Turnstile, speed, cumul
ative distance, etc.) collect. In addition, the control center for voice communi
cation and Microphone, in the car to send to the emergency control center, p
erforms for the Panic Button and interface.
Information for passengers in the passenger terminal (PID) and external infor
mation terminal (EID) provides information on the text, the driver of the vehi
cle through a LCD monitor current service status (planned contrast variation,
the current stops, etc.) and provides various alarms and messages should.

6. Warning
FCC RF INTERFERENCE STATEMENT
NOTE :
This equipment has been tested and found to comply with the limits for a Class B digital
device, pursuant to Part 15 of the FCC Rules. These limits are designed to provide
reasonable protection against harmful interference in a residential installation.
This equipment generates, uses and can radiate radio frequency energy and, if not
installed and used in accordance with the instructions, may cause harmful interference to
radio communications. However, there is no guarantee that interference will not occur in a
particular installation.
If this equipment does cause harmful interference to radio or television reception which
can be determined by turning the equipment off and on, the user is encouraged to try to
correct the interference by one or more of the following measures.
Reorient or relocate the receiving antenna.
Increase the separation between the equipment and receiver.
Connect the equipment into an outlet on a circuit different from that to
which the receiver is connected.
Consult the dealer or an experienced radio, TV technical for help.
Only shielded interface cable should be used.
Finally, any changes or modifications to the equipment by the user not expressly
approved by the grantee or manufacturer could void the users authority to operate
such equipment
